What's The Definition Of Tatter?

tatter in American English
a torn and hanging shred or piece, as of a garment
to become ragged
to reduce to tatters; make ragged

tatter in American English 1
noun: a torn piece hanging loose from the main part, as of a garment or flag

tatter in American English 2
noun: a person who does tatting, esp. as an occupation

tatter in British English
noun: torn or ragged pieces, esp of material
verb: to make or become ragged or worn to shreds
